Missing shingles after a windstorm aren't just cosmetic — they leave the roof deck exposed to water and accelerate the failure of surrounding shingles. Atlas Roofing replaces missing shingles in Woodmere fast, matches color where possible, and addresses the underlying cause.

Woodmere is mostly the Eton Chagrin Boulevard commercial corridor — flat-roof systems on retail buildings, restaurant TPO, and small office EPDM — so most of our work here is commercial maintenance and repair rather than residential.
The handful of residential properties along Brainard Road tend to be older bungalows with original framing that needs sheathing inspection during tear-offs.
